Marko Arnautovic signs contract extension with West Ham

West Ham striker, Marko Arnautovic has signed a contract extension. The 29-year-old had been in the spotlight, following a £35m bid from a Chinese club with wages hovering around £200,000 weekly.

By committing to the Hammers, the Austrian playmaker has put a stop to the torrent of speculations as the transfer window wind down.

Arnautovic arrived at the London-based club in 2017 from Stoke City in a then club record transfer fee of £20m released a statement saying, “I want to say to the fans that I’m happy to stay. I’m glad to play again, show myself and score goals, to make assists, but also to say that the major point is Marko Arnautovic never refused [to play or train]. I would never refuse.

“The fans gave me the power, they gave me the energy and that’s why I have to be here and that’s why I want to stay. I never wanted to run away because I hate this club, this was never my intention.”

Before he handed a transfer request, Marko Arnautovic’s contract was bound to expire in 2022.
